The movie is about how 4 talented friends with same passion for music creates a band called Magik and wanted to become 'somebody' in music industry. The movie focuses on how they stay together, achieve what they want to, broke up with each other and re-unites one last time. Director has done a marvelous job in bringing all characters alive. He didn't allow more characters floating all around and coming in between. He simply focuses on Magik and their select close ones.
Soul of this movie lies in its music. The music of Rock On! is packed with extremely catchy kick ass numbers. Though all the numbers are rocking but my top three favorites are 'Zehreelay' 'Pichhle Saat Dinon' and 'Ye Tumhari Meri Baatein'. 'Zehreelay' is the heaviest soundtrack of any Indian movie so far. It's wild, full of energy and extremely noisy. Lyrics are weird and the interesting part is the vocal. You can do extreme screaming when you sing in English but when it comes to Hindi, it's a different ball game. It is tough to sing so loud and extreme that too with perfect vocals in Hindi. Simply hell yeah! 'Pichhle saat dinon' is a song that grows on you and later, you can't live without. The song is so popular that they have made a spl video for it. 'Ye Tumhari Meri Baatein' is beautiful song with a tinge of jazz to it. It will make you feel as if it is made for you and your love. Another wonderful track is 'Socha hai'. It's like back to roots, real rock song where lyrics come out from no where. Title soundtrack 'Rock On!', 'Sindbad the sailor' and 'Fir Dekhiye' are simply outstanding. Another special song is a slow rock ballad 'Tum ho to'. In age of one song wonder soundtracks Rock On! is a surprise package. Each and every song is a chart buster. It tells the story about four young friends who put together a wonderful band called 'Magik' but could never make it big. The movie brilliantly depicts the life of aspiring rock stars in India and carefully handles their rise, fall and reunion. The whole movie see-saws between the past and the present which keeps the viewer interested.
Acting is also nice. Frahan Akhtar acts well and is a capable singer. Though I hope he doesn't become Himesh #2 and keeps his singing within limits. Rest of the cast- Arjun, Purab, Luke, Prachi and Sahana also do well.
As for the negatives, the movie was a little lengthy. Plus, I believe the incident with "Rob" was unnecessary which didn't suit the general "feel-good" mood of the film.
Despite some shortcomings, Rock on!! is indeed a noteworthy attempt and needs to be applauded. Well done.

- TriviaThe lead vocalist Aditya's birthday in the movie is repeatedly highlighted as July 22. This referred to the real birthday of Don Henley, the lead vocalist of the Eagles. The lead guitarist's name is Joseph Mascarenhas, nick-named Joe which is the same as one of the lead guitarists of the Eagles, Joe Walsh.
- GoofsWhen the group goes on to perform in the competition after reunion, Debbie asks Joe to take the job on the cruise. When they board the Taxi, Debbie asks Taxi driver to take them to Airport instead of Sea Port.
